Seneca, Paul VI & Shawnee girls titles secure Olympic Conf. Tourney titles
Sofia Basto-Cabrera of Shawnee hits a return in first singles during the Burlington Open girls tennis finals at Lenape High School in Medford, NJ on 9/18/25.Scott Faytok | NJ Advance Media

Shawnee swept both American division titles, and Seneca and Paul VI each earned first-place crowns in the National division at the Olympic Conference Tournament on Wednesday at Eastern.

Sofia Basto-Cabrera led the way for Shawnee with a 6-0, 6-1 win over Victoria vonHahmann in the American singles championship.
